Changing Paths, Finding Skies

A young 1st Lt. Bryan Driskell (left), an AC-130W Stinger II aircraft pilot with the 16th Special Operations Squadron, poses for a photo with his siblings at McKinney, Texas. Growing up with six siblings gave Driskell a sense of unity and team building that he now applies to his aircrew. (Courtesy Photo)
